Output 91abaf945905b10cae00562aadd98a7f98a71fead8c549e5fe0f94f7eadc9fc7:1

value
1026462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f851ff8b355e805e2d2f57d6c0e176595a4d87c7 OP_EQUALVERIFY OP_CHECKSIG
address
1PdzounFtWanfobhscg2psw1crxzwdveKi
transaction
91abaf945905b10cae00562aadd98a7f98a71fead8c549e5fe0f94f7eadc9fc7
spent
true